Post by sairsint » Fri Jul 28, 2023 10:56 am

What a ridiculous answer to this TD's certification delay question:

https://www.oireachtas.ie/en/debates/qu ... naturalise

"My Department trialled this new format at the recent March Citizenship Ceremonies in the RDS. This had the aim to test the best means of increasing the number of ceremonies annually in order to naturalise more applicants more frequently."

So by posting them out after the ceremony (some over a month later) somehow allows for more ceremonies to take place?? The only sense (and I use that word lightly) that I can conclude is they only know who will be attending the next ceremony right up to the week or two beforehand and there is no time for them to print and provide them on the day.
